13-2508. Resisting arrest;
classification


A. A person commits resisting arrest by intentionally preventing or attempting to
prevent a person reasonably known to him to be a peace officer, acting under color of
such peace officer's official authority, from effecting an arrest by:


1. Using or threatening to use physical force against the peace officer or another;
or


2. Using any other means creating a substantial risk of causing physical injury to
the peace officer or another.


B. Resisting arrest is a class 6 felony.
